Webster's Dictionary [1]

(n. pl.) A tribe of North American Indians (Southern Appalachian) allied to the Choctaws. They formerly occupied the northern part of Alabama and Mississippi, but now live in the Indian Territory.

The Nuttall Encyclopedia [2]

N. American Indians, allied to the Chocktaws, settled in a civilised state in the Indian Territory like the Cherokees.
